Nancy Cohen Sculptures
Nancy Cohen has an MFA from Columbia University and a BFA from Rochester Institute of Technology. Recent projects include installations in Karmiel, Israel; the CODA Museum in Holland; the Katonah Museum of Art in NY and a collaboration with environmentalists based on the Mullica River for the Noyes Museum of Art in New Jersey. She has been awarded a Pollock Krasner Grant, residencies at The Millay Colony and Yaddo and multiple Fellowships in Sculpture and Works on Paper from the NJ State Council on the Arts. Cohen was born in Queens, New York, and lives in Jersey City, NJ.
